The Acaeum page for the X-series notes that the scenario for X8 was originally run at Gamesfair 81, "where it was possibly titled "Island of Death"". So that page could be updated with the correct title, per the third photo: TEKI-NURA-RIA: The Mountain of Death.

I also note that the page for the UK series says: "The working title for UK7 was "Teki Nura Ria"", but that's clearly an error in view of this find.
